What they do
GateWay Boarding Academy [GBA] Continues to Work Diligently to Maintain A Cadre of Volunteers and to Identify Potential Staff Members In Order to Maximize Continued Program Growth While Balancing Program Cost Increases. This Year We Strengthened Our Instructional Effectiveness By Attracting and Hiring A Retired Teacher/media Specialist With A Heart to Serve Youth, and Years of Experience Meeting The Instructional Needs of A Similar Student Body. Additionally, GBA Continued to Vet All Its Staff and Volunteers Through An Extensive Background HR Screening Process, and Youth Protection & Reporting Training. Also, This Year, Our After-School, Structured Instructional Support Time [A.S.S.I.S.T] Program Continued to Use HMHs [Houghton/ Mifflin/Harcourt] READ 180 and MATH 180 Programs.
